A motherboard has been updated to:

    Intel Celeron B366
    Jetways Motherboard

Now ARev1 and OI still run but ARev3 displays:

    Initialisation in Process

and goes no further.

Other terminals are fine.

Any one have a similar experience?

Run AREV from a shortcut, make the environment][size=1024, and disable expanded memory in the shortcut. Set regular RAM to 560 kB and try again. I'm tipping expanded memory timing is a problem.

You might try starting AREV with the /E option to disable the floating point co-processor on the CPU. That's been a problem in the past with some CPUs, but I haven't seen it recently; however, it might be worth a try.
